Crucial Partner Promotion Data You Require to Understand

Staying up-to-date about the recent affiliate marketing landscape is necessary for success. But wading through a information can be difficult. Here are some vital statistics every affiliate marketer should track. Conversion rates are key—aim for at least 2-3% for good performance. Click-through rates (CTR) usually hover between 1-5%, but increased CTRs demonstrate attractive ad copy. Your average order value (AOV) is another key metric; improving AOV directly impacts your income. Finally, keep a careful eye on your ROI—it’s the final measure of your revenue marketing campaigns. Monitoring these figures consistently will enable you to improve your approaches and boost your returns.
